The General Lab Supervisor is responsible for day to day laboratory operational supervision, including personnel management, resolving technical problems and maintaining the integrity of Non-Surgical Orthopaedics laboratory high complexity testing. Essential Functions & Responsibilities

· Monitor test analyses and specimen examinations to ensure that acceptable levels of analytic performance are maintained.

· Engage in sample preparation and running LC-MS for drug monitoring.

· Ensure patient test results are not reported until all correction action has been taken and the test system is functioning properly.

· Resolve technical problems and ensure remedial action is taken whenever test systems deviate from the laboratory’s established performance specifications.

· Perform routine and preventative maintenance on all instruments to ensure optimum performance.

· Monitor trends in service requests and implement corrective actions to improve operational efficiency and reduce downtime of all instruments.

· Monitor performance of equipment by implementing QA and QC procedures.

· Support, implement and ensure compliance with company policies and procedures including but not limited to Quality and Safety.

· Review and enforce CLIA laboratory policies and procedures.

· Accessible to testing personnel at all times testing is performed to provide on-site, telephone or electronic support and supervision.

· Provide day to day supervision of personnel performing high complexity testing.

· Provide orientation to all testing personnel.

· Participate in personnel performance management including employee performance evaluations, coaching sessions, training, etc.

· Work collaboratively with others, including consulting Laboratory Director and Technical Supervisor.

· Work constructively with remote Laboratory Director and Technical Supervisor.

Qualifications

· 2 – 4 years of experience with LC-MS in a clinical setting preferred. At least 2 years of high complexity testing in toxicology is required. One year of LC-MS experience is required.

· Must fulfill one of the CLIA required criteria for General Laboratory Supervisor.

· Familiar with CLIA regulatory requirements.

· Basic laboratory skills including preparation of solvents, standards and solutions preps.
